20. I've Found Some Stuff From Then...
Trying to google Clinton + Gore brings up a ton of hate sites...but here's a couple that speak about where they were regarding 9/11:

http://www.cnn.com/2001/WORLD/asiapcf/09/12/terror.clinton/

Clinton had been scheduled to travel to Taiwan on Wednesday but postponed his trip.

"He'll obviously want to return to the U.S. as soon as possible," Queensland Premier Peter Beattie said.

----

Former U.S. Vice President Al Gore, meanwhile, was stranded in Austria as many airlines canceled flights to the United States and U.S. airports remained closed Wednesday morning.

Gore was in Vienna, where he had been scheduled to speak to the Internet Service Providers Austria on the future of the Internet. In a written statement to the Austria Press Agency, Gore condemned the terrorist attacks in New York and Washington as "an unspeakably evil act."
<snip>

I remember Clinton talking about it shortly thereafter...Gore even spent the night at the Clinton's home as they drove all night from Montreal. Damn would I have loved to have been in that car. IIRC, Clinton said he and Gore talked that night about the 2000 election and Gore admitted that he should have run on Clinton's record, not away from it.

I've looked for a specific story to corroborate this...maybe someone else can help here.
